  1. Hi, at least in my opinion, I would say that fairly light feedings with a pretty clean food would probably be alright, especially with the low nitrate levels you've mentioned (just don't go overboard).

    One thing with bettas and baby brine is that (at least for my betta) a pipette really helps as they like to only pay attention to the shrimp when they can get a bunch of shrimp in a single bite. (so just slowly squeeze in a dense pipette of brine shrimp right in front of him, and he'll probably get the hang of it)

  6. Hi, I'm not @Torrey, but I have kept a sparkling gourami before. They're really fun, and make an awesome croaking sound (similar to a frog), however they can be shy. Mine often hid below the heater quite often, although I'm not sure if that was only when I was around; I did't get to have her that long.

    I'd also really make sure to have a lid for them. I put mine in a breeder box since there was a good chance it was harassing the shrimps, but it ended up jumping out, and getting lost under a piece of furniture.
